WebA cystic component was present on CT in six (35%) of 17 cases. On sonography, the solid tumor component was hyperechoic to normal renal parenchyma in six of seven cases and isoechoic in the other. On MR imaging, all tumors (4/4) were hypointense on T2-weighted imaging. On urography, all lesions (5/5) distorted the intrarenal collecting system. WebEosinophilic Solid and Cystic Type Renal Cell Carcinoma is an emerging subtype of renal cell carcinoma. Predominantly affects females without a specific age range (has been found anywhere from from 14-75 years old). Individuals usually present with painless hematuria and lack clinical symptoms associated with tuberous sclerosis complex. rbc clearbrook abbotsford https://xavierfarre.com

WebAug 8, 2024 · RCC accounts for over 3% of all adult malignancies and has several histological subtypes. The year 2024 estimates suggest that 73,750 cases of renal cancers will be detected (5% of all cancers in males and 3% of all cancers in females), and 14,830 persons will die from the disease.
